We met in October of 2006. Ashley was a sophomore and Joe was a freshman at Chicopee High School. We met at Friday night football game at Szot Park in Chicopee through mutual friends. Most of our communication took place through AIM (now extinct!!) because we didn’t have any classes together. We started dating on December 9, 2006 and have been inseparable ever since.

We had just purchased our first home together on November 28 of 2016. Little did Ashley know, Joe had been planning to propose from that moment. It was on December 11, 2017 that he popped the question. Joe had planned to do it two nights prior, but Ashley was just not cooperating; she had other plans for the weekend and kept Joe on his toes, even forcing him to take the ring with him to Walmart! Finally, on Sunday night, right before his hockey game, Joe told Ashley to be quiet for just a minute (she hadn’t stopped all weekend!). He got down on one knee in the middle of the kitchen and asked Ashley to marry him. To his and her surprise (Ashley had no idea this was going to happen!), Ashley said ‘Thank You!’. She was so shocked she forgot to say Yes!! After the excitement and Joe asking again, she finally said ‘Yes”.

Cakes by Amanda- 16 Cat Alley, Barre, MA 01005; (978) 257-4136; https://www.facebook.com/CustomCakesbyAmanda/ -Flavors: Chocolate and Vanilla marble cake with a ‘tuxedo filling’—chocolate ganache and cream cheese with delicious cream cheese frosting. -The cake was the best we’ve ever tasted! It literally melted in your mouth! The design was simple, but went along with our theme perfectly. Amanda customized one tier to look like a white birch tree (our theme) with our initials carved in. The other tiers were whimsical ruffles to give depth, but simplicity to not take away from the focus of the birch tier.
